“Our society is quite serious, and I believe that they will comply with quarantine rules”, said today Ulvi Mehdiyev, chairman of the State Agency for Public Service and Innovations under the President of the Azerbaijan Republic at the press conference of the Task Force under the Cabinet of Ministers, APA reports.

The agency chairman said some time ago, there was the SMS system for obtaining a permission: "70-80 percent of the applications for permission received during the initial days were irrelevant SMS messages. Later on, as a result of public reprimand and the taken measures, such actions were prevented. Due to such appeals of unserious persons, the necessary SMS message of another person was received with delay. And now we call on citizens not to refer to 108 Call Center and drugstores in unnecessary cases. Thanks to this, the persons with really urgent needs would be able to immediately reach the phone numbers of those facilities ands to voice their problems and the state structures would be able to provide assistance to them”.
